> I've been using a Canon 20D a lot for the past 3 years, and have 
> neglected the OM4t except for backpacking trips.  Yesterday I got out 
> the Olympus to use up some of the film that's been  in the cooler.  I 
> loaded and advanced the film, and the shutter locked up.  I removed the 
> film and tried everything I know of and still can't get the shutter to 
> operate correctly.  I think the batteries are OK.  Any ideas? Thanks.

1) Put the shutter ring on B, what does the camera do ?
2) "I think the batteries are OK" means try some other
    Silver Oxide batteries :-)
